Is FPGA solution is cheaper than ASIC?

0
10

In ASIC design NRE cost is high , but unit cost is less. Where as in FPGA based design the NRE cost is less but unit cost is high (compared to ASIC). FPGAs are costlier when we compare with ASIC for a bulk production. It means if we produce the chips in a large quantity then the ASIC would be cheaper, but where as if we produce the chips for small quantity then the FPGA will be cheaper. That is the reason most of the commercial Hardware like Mobile Phone, Cameras come with ASIC. Because they are made in a bulk so that cost per piece is small.
